I did a one pot with, new potatoes, red,green and yellow peppers, red onion, fennel, courgette, sweet potato tomatoes and salmon steaks that were marinated in a sauce of anchovy, capers, gherkin, sweet chilli sauce, olive oil and honey that was whizzed up in the processor.
Veggies baked in the oven for 50 minutes then salmon and marinade added for 20 minutes. Delicious.
